Location

The property is located within a rural yet accessible location between A14 and A140, The larger village of Creeting St Mary is close by and amenities within the extended village include a popular local primary school, community centre and local parish church. The quaint village of Coddenham and Stonham Aspall are a short drive away.

Needham Market is approximately 2 miles away and provides a High Street full of independent shops, cafe's and pubs. The Train Station in Needham Market provides a direct link to Ipswich and Lowestoft.

The property is easily accessed from Norwich and the North via the A140, and from Ipswich and the West and South via the A14.
